Output faf1766342dcd87882dee1b33db90f156162e077daf4500ea9e8d7d1683d2319:1

value
7558
script pubkey
OP_0 OP_PUSHBYTES_20 338bc1b5ea127b7c750492fe2668c9c99a1e73d4
address
bc1qxw9urd02zfahcagyjtlzv6xfexdpuu75uwh68s
transaction
faf1766342dcd87882dee1b33db90f156162e077daf4500ea9e8d7d1683d2319
spent
true